R. Sandulache et al., GENETIC INSTABILITY AT THE AGOUTI LOCUS OF THE MOUSE (MUS MUSCULUS) .1. INCREASED REVERSE MUTATION FREQUENCY TO THE A(W) ALLELE IN A A HETEROZYGOTES/, Genetics, 137(4), 1994, pp. 1079-1087
We have compiled the reverse mutation rate data to the white bellied a
gouti (A(w)) allele in heterozygous A/a mice and shown it to be increa
sed by a factor of at least 350 in comparison to the reverse mutation
rate in homozygous a/a mice. Employing tightly linked flanking restric
tion fragment length polymorphism DNA markers, we have shown that reve
rsion to A(w) is associated with crossing over in the vicinity of the
agouti locus. The non-agouti (a) allele has been recently shown to con
tain an 11-kb insert within the first intron of the agouti gene. Toget
her with our present results, these observations suggest possible mech
anisms to explain the reversion events.
